Mechanical trap damage inflicted upon the wearer is reduced by 5. It has no effect on magical trap damage.
The effect from this item stacks with other items that mitigate mechanical trap-damage.
Mechanical Trap: a physical (non-magical) hazard that gets sprung on the party as they advance through the adventure. Puzzles are not traps. “Push” damage as a result of not completing a room challenge in time is not a trap.

Monster Trophy tokens can only be found in the random treasure generators found at the end of an adventure. Each represents either a portion of a creature, statuary, flora, or raw materials (e.g., metals or minerals) found within a True Dungeon adventure.
Monster Trophy tokens have black lettering and gold backs (or brown lettering on wood in 2006). They are primarily used to make Combo/Transmuted tokens and are often highly-prized by token collectors.
